160000 Hand Surgery Illustration


   
160000 Hand Surgery Illustration

Exhibit Number: 160000 Enlarge My Lightbox

Palmar view of hand surgery. The short flexor, opponens, and abductor brevis muscles are repaired. The sural nerve is harvested from the lower left leg and is used to repair the nerves to the thumb.
